Thanks to all of the providers who came along and supported the Greater Wellington Veterans' Support Forum at Te Rauparaha Arena yesterday. Veterans and their whanau turned out in droves to meet with Veterans' Affairs New Zealand staff and other financial, health and wellbeing, and veteran organisations.

A visit from Rt Hon Chris Penk MP Minister for Veterans and Minister of Defence topped the day off.

Today is International Nurses Day. Celebrated around the world every May 12, for the anniversary of Florence Nightingale's birth. To celebrate this day, we thought we would share some history about our nurses.

Since the First World War, the Army’s Nursing Officers have served in every major conflict New Zealand has been involved in. More than 500 nurses served in the First World War and more than 600 joined the Second World War effort, serving in the Pacific, Egypt, England, Greece, Crete, Syria, Tunisia and Italy. Back then they were called the New Zealand Army Nursing Service (NZANS). In 1953 the NZANS became the Royal New Zealand Nursing Corps (RNZNC), and the first RNZNC officer was later sent to Vietnam to work with the Australians at Vung Tau.
